Instagram users across the United States are reporting widespread issues with the platform’s direct messaging (DM) feature today, March 12, 2026. The outage, which began early this morning, has left millions unable to send or receive messages, sparking frustration and confusion among both individual users and businesses reliant on the platform for communication.

Reports of the outage flooded social media platforms like Twitter and Reddit, with hashtags such as #InstagramDown and #DMsNotWorking trending nationally. Users have described encountering error messages, delayed message delivery, or complete inability to access their inboxes. The issue appears to affect both the Instagram app and its web version.

Meta, Instagram’s parent company, acknowledged the problem in a brief statement released midday. “We are aware of an issue impacting Instagram DMs and are working to resolve it as quickly as possible,” a spokesperson said. However, no specific timeline for a fix has been provided.

The outage has had significant real-world consequences, particularly for small businesses and creators who rely on Instagram DMs for customer inquiries, collaborations, and sales. “This is incredibly frustrating,” said Sarah Thompson, a freelance photographer based in Chicago. “I use DMs to communicate with clients daily, and this outage is costing me time and money.”

Public reaction has been mixed, with some users expressing annoyance at the inconvenience while others have taken a more lighthearted approach, joking about the outage on Twitter. “Guess I’ll have to talk to people in real life today,” quipped one user.

This isn’t the first time Instagram has faced technical issues. The platform experienced a similar outage in October 2025, which lasted several hours and affected multiple features. However, today’s incident appears to be more focused on the DM functionality, raising questions about the platform’s reliability.

As of this afternoon, there is no indication of when the issue will be fully resolved. Users are advised to check Instagram’s official status page for updates and consider alternative communication methods in the meantime.
